摘要

This study analyzes the effectiveness of the Korean government's technology R&D projects in energy conservation, which were implemented from 1992 to 2000. Applying the energy technology tree, we classified the projects into five major sectors: industry, furnace/metal, building, transportation, and electricity. The results and outcomes of the R&D projects were analyzed via cross-plot analyses by using the commercialization success ratio, royalty payments, and project budgets. Statistical analyses showed that 50 projects were commercially successful, which represents 12.9% of 387 projects. About 32% of the projects were ranked as "excellent" and about 12% of the projects were discontinued ones.
